Women empowerment is the foundation of development: RSS chief gave a message to break backward traditions

Nagpur

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) chief Mohan Bhagwat said on Friday that empowerment of women is very important for the progress of any country and they should be freed from old and backward thinking traditions. He was speaking at an event organized by a non-governmental organization named Industrial Vardhini in Solapur, Maharashtra.

‘Women are the most important part of any society’
Mohan Bhagwat said, ‘Women are the most important part of any society. A man works for a lifetime, a woman also works throughout his life, but beyond that she inspires generations to come. Children’s minds and rites develop only in the affection of the mother.

She further said that women empowerment is mandatory not only for society, but for the development of the entire country. Mohan Bhagwat said, ‘God has given an additional feature to women, so that they can do all that men are unable to do. Also, they have all the qualities like men. Therefore, she can do everything equal to men. ‘

On October 2, 100 years of establishment of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S) are being completed. There is also Vijaya Dashami on the day of Gandhi Jayanti on 2 October. The Sangh was established on the day of Vijaya Dashami.

The Sangh has called for its new and old volunteers to reach branches on 2 October. On the one hand, Ramdhun will ring, while there will be more than 100 volunteers in the branches.

All India Publicity Head Sunil Ambekar discussed the centenary year programs at the All India Province Campaign meeting of the Union in Delhi from 4-6 July.

A senior official of the Ghar-Ghar Sampark Abhiyan Sangh said that in the centenary year, the Sangh will not organize any major program to gather crowds in UP. Branches will perform branches at Gram Panchayat, Nyaya Panchayat, Block level to join the common people.

There will be seminars of 100 to 200 people in the districts. Small seminars will also be held at the branch level. There will be Hindu conferences at the settlement level in the mandal and urban areas in the rural. The Sangh will launch the biggest campaign of ‘Home Contact’ so far. In this, volunteers will go to 25 to 30 houses and give information about the works of the union.
